Segments that transform the industry

  • In line with the formulation, the global leak detection dye is divided into these segments: solvent-based leak detection dye, water-based leak detection dye, and oil-based leak detection dye. Among them, solvent-based dyes have gained a significant market share because of their great solubility, high visibility under UV light, and their adjustment to a broad spectrum of systems, especially in both automotive and industrial sectors. They have been beneficial in locating leakages in fuel, oil, and refrigerant systems, which makes them a favorite to use in all sectors. Besides, the continuous development of low-toxicity and low-VOC solvent formulations is further cementing their usage in the environmentally controlled markets.

According to the report, Rising Demand in Industrial Applications has been identified as a key driver for market growth. Some of how this impact has been felt include:

The increasing use of leak detection dyes in the industrial sector is a major factor boosting its growth in the global market. The use and development of leak detectors in industries like oil and gas, the automotive industry, manufacturing industries, and heating, ventilation, and air-conditioning systems are very important due to the increasing demand of these industries. Such sectors are dependent on sophisticated systems such as pipelines, machinery, and reservoirs of fluid storage, whose minor leakage may cause significant hiccups in operations, safety, and environmental degradation.

Dyes applied in leak detection are a cheap and fast way of detecting leaks in such complex systems. The fact that they fluoresce in ultraviolet light, or, given the leak, change in color, enables technicians to very easily identify and solve problems before they become larger than life. The early identification can avoid the expensive downtime and maintenance costs, as well as minimize the number of accidents.

Moreover, due to the increased regulatory attention to environmental protection and safety issues in the workplace, industries must implement even closer practices and approaches to leak detection use. Leak detection dyes fit very suitably to the above-mentioned needs, particularly as there has been the development of environmentally and non-hazardous dyes. This set of operational efficiency, regulatory compliance, and safety towards the environment is part of the reason they are gaining a lot of use in other sectors/industries and is one of the pushes to expansion and growth within the leak detection dye industry.
